Output 73b85471ab9787a4924b43e084b09682098a5eaa807887abd1dca667b3dfb75d:3

value
611969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77333ee35fd33c21c18c36276bcad235f5a2f52e OP_EQUAL
address
3CZHiyvWdAGvWLec8ig8MXorP7jekknCQb
transaction
73b85471ab9787a4924b43e084b09682098a5eaa807887abd1dca667b3dfb75d
spent
true